The best way to install keystone is with yeoman generator. Keystonejs web hosting 20x faster keystonejs hosting. For this id need a way to inject some custom js and html in the respective listing page, but im not sure how to do that, if its even possible. Hi generally, i am extremely happy with the friendly, no fuss and technically proficient service provided by a2 hosting. We start with an overview of keystone projects and domains, which are selection from identity, authentication, and access management in openstack book. Developing web apps and restful apis with keystonejs. If you prefer to jump straight to code, feel free to skip the stepbystep tutorial and see the quick start page. Find out how to control web servers, and create eventdriven programs and scripts with node. Backend developers with experience in working with mvc frameworks will find themselves at ease since the beginning, but developers who work on the frontend only will have a hard time finding what they are supposed to do to set up templates and such. Ghost vs keystonejs detailed comparison as of 2020 slant. It is one of the best cms out there written with node.
Oct, 2015 3 thoughts on setting up keystonejs cms in ubuntu christroutner october 19, 2015 at 3. The installer uses chocolatey, which has its own requirements. The framework is built upon express and mongodb express is a minimalist web framework for node. Cover and chapter illustrations by madalina tantareanu. The yeoman workflow comprises three types of tools for improving your productivity and satisfaction when building a web app. For those of you developing web applications and sites using node. Using keystonejs for managing pages showing 15 of 5 messages. I modified some things like using js to change the image in the header, and im sure you can minimize the css further by creating more less rules, but other than those minor changes, the template is pretty much the same. This documentation is useful for contributors looking to get involved in our community, developers writing applications on. A mere 1second page load delay impacts your bounce rate, seo rankings and even your conversion rate. After answering all generator questions run the app with the following command. Released around 6 months ago, keystone provides a framework built on tried and tested components to give developers a quick start with building web applications in node. Learn to set up a development environment and an empty project, work with models to.
Our keystonejs hosting is designed to be powerful and userfriendly with leading support. Top 10 headless cmss you should check out and what they are. There are gazillions of other options out there, but after three years of tracking down the perfect node. Licensed under a creative commons attributionnoncommercial license. Is there a functional language which compiles to js and allows usage of js libraries. Possui alguns plugins ja disponiveis na instalacao. Its released as a 12 mb javascript file supporting the architectures. Does keystone configure mongo to be safer and more stable than a default mongo install. This tutorial book shows how to build javascript frontend web applications with angularjs and the cloud storage. This documentation is useful for contributors looking to get involved in our community, developers writing applications on top of openstack, and. There are some good thing that come with it but it does limit the list of cms that i could use. Learn how to build javascript applications with node. Check another tutorials to increase the complexity of your code keeping secure and efficient. Arm, arm64, hexagon, mips, powerpc, sparc, systemz and x86.
Keystone is an openstack service that provides api client authentication, service discovery, and distributed multitenant authorization by implementing openstacks identity api. However, you shouldnt take from there because the current version of keystonejs create a different structure using locals. The webs scaffolding tool for modern webapps yeoman. After i clarified why the code is similar, its time to explain what step 4 commit contains and why we do in these way. Custom fields in the admin item page that i dont want autogenerated by keystone from the model. More advanced extensions is the primary reason people pick factor over the competition. Click to see how to get a to do app up and running in under 4 minutes with the keystone 5 cli. By the end of this tutorial, you will be able to understand the basics of node.
The library for searching and exploring gatsbys vast plugin ecosystem to implement node. Keystone makes it easy to create sophisticated web sites and apps, and comes with a beautiful autogenerated admin ui. Keystore explorer is an open source gui replacement for the java commandline utilities keytool and jarsigner. Keystone 5 introduces firstclass graphql support, a new extensible architecture, and an improved admin ui. A class of your choosing to add to the container to add custom styles to your croppie. Fundamental keystone topics identity, authentication. It also updates the state to authenticated and stores result in access. Webpack, d3, jquery, ionic framework, modular javascript, objectoriented javascript, bing maps v8, aurelia, keystone. Setting up keystonejs cms in ubuntu experiments in freedom.
Croppie is an easy to use javascript image cropper. However, for the purposes of this tutorial, well start from scratch. Once keystone server sends a response to this api client it will call the function callback with the result, if provided. Keystone follows mvc practices in managing routes, views and templates. We will generate an application and then add a productsstore section to the app. This page is powered by a knowledgeable community that helps you make an informed decision. Books included in this category cover topics related to javascript such as angular, react, react. I had looked around and install a couple of nodejs based cms based on this post best node. This is just a little starter for a pet project or if you want to become familiar with headles cms or keystonejs.
Meteor supports windows 7windows server 2008 r2 and up. You wont have to worry about any of this when you choose a2 hosting and our screaming fast swiftserver platform. It supports several templating engines and css preprocessors. Is there a way to hijack the keystone view for a specific model type and add custom elements. We are going to build a blog with image handling, secure admin login, user management and transactional email without hardly writing any code. Keystore explorer presents their functionality, and. A keystonejs project with various configurations for development and testing purposes javascript mit 24 27 0 6 updated nov 1, 2019 keystone storageadapterazure. Additionally, i want to thanks the creators of keystone demo repository where i extracted most of this code. Factor, ghost, and keystonejs are probably your best bets out of the options considered. Croppie a simple javascript image cropper foliotek. However, this is a basic tutorial doesnt contain elements as comment moderation, asynchronous comments load or cross site scripting. First, create a new keystone application using the keystoneapp command. If you want to read a deverting tutorial about this code has been put together, head over to our zauberware blog and read the stepbystep explanation. Fundamental keystone topics in this chapter we provide an introduction to the basic foundations of keystone.
Take advantage of this course called beginning node. Download free javascript ebooks in pdf format or read books online. Prior to using ghost i had rocked up a keystonejs blog. Click to see how to get a to do app up and running in. Free bootstrap template for keystone js showing 16 of 6 messages.
Sep 14, 2016 top 10 headless cmss you should check out and what they are. Keystone, the openstack identity service keystone is an openstack service that provides api client authentication, service discovery, and distributed multitenant authorization by implementing openstacks identity api. Just a blogging platform if you need just a blog, i highly recommend using ghost, but if you want to run a website or launch a web app with a blog, keystone. Tells croppie to read exif orientation from the image data and orient the image correctly before. Keystore explorer presents their functionality, and more, via an intuitive graphical user interface. Hosting on speed optimized servers with your choice of server location, free ssds and our up to 20x faster turbo servers are all advantages of. In mongodb, a collection is not created until it gets content. Feb 08, 2017 in this video we will look at the node.
1096 644 1457 271 1455 1263 1301 376 701 1416 1163 530 655 946 694 528 883 785 588 91 558 747 532 1058 1047 894 729 1093 360 1411 381 112 1501 4 1447 1480 1210 1029 1500 1440 1481 937 386 320 963 42 949 1054 850 3 724